26

私はそれを検索しようとしますが、私はできません。LenovoG460ラップトップでWindows7を実行しています。Ubuntuをインストールしようとしましたが、何らかの理由でワイヤレスを使用してインターネットに接続できません。

とにかく、Androidのソースコードまたは少なくともそのカレンダー部分だけを見ることができますか?

4

7 に答える 7

29

リポジトリブラウザを使用してAndroidのソースコードを閲覧できます。特定のプロジェクトをチェックアウトする(つまり、ソースをダウンロードする)場合は、バージョン管理システムGitを入手する必要があります。Gitを実行している場合は、を使用して完全なリポジトリのクローンを作成するか、を実行しgit clone https://android.googlesource.com/projectname.gitてHEAD(すべてのファイルの最新バージョン。ソースを参照するだけの場合に便利)を取得できますgit clone --depth 1 https://android.googlesource.com/projectname.git

プロジェクト名は、カレンダーアプリなど、リポジトリブラウザで選択した最上位のフォルダです。platform/packages/apps/Calendar次に、完全なコマンドはgit clone https://android.googlesource.com/platform/packages/apps/Calendarです。

于 2010-04-30T17:51:51.983 に答える
15

この質問に最初に回答したため、Android用のGitWebおよびGoogleコード検索リポジトリは廃止されました。幸い、SDK Managerを使用すると、Android4.0以降のソースコード をすべてのAPIとツールとともにダウンロードできるようになります。

アイスクリームサンドイッチ(4.0)以前のAndroidソースコードにアクセスする必要があり、GoogleのWindows以外のダウンロード手順を使用したくない場合は、 GrepCodeでオンラインで必要なものを検索できます。(「android」と必要なクラスまたはメソッドの名前を探してから、必要なコードのバージョンを選択します。)GrepCodeは機能しますが、IEが何度もクラッシュするのを目にしました。別の方法は、Eclipse用のAndroid Sourcesプラグインをダウンロードすることです。これにより、4.0.1までのバージョンのAndroidのすべてのソースコードが提供されます。

ソースコードを入手したら、次のように、使用しているソースディレクトリをEclipseの.jarにアタッチできます。

プロジェクトを右クリック>プロパティ> Javaビルドパス>ライブラリタブ>ソースコードを添付する.jarの横にある+を選択>ソース添付をクリックして、ソースファイルが存在する場所へのパスを編集します。

于 2012-01-27T20:23:58.313 に答える
2

どうもありがとう、ウィンドウズでのダウンロードを助けるためのクイックガイド、これをチェックしてください

http://honey200.wordpress.com/2011/11/17/download-android-source-code-in-windows/

于 2011-11-17T19:17:59.807 に答える
2

手順:

  1. Cygwinをhttp://cygwin.com/install.htmlからダウンロードします。
  2. ほとんどすべてのデフォルトでcygwinをインストールします。cygwinのセットアップ中に、モジュールcurlを選択してpython(それらを検索し)、インストールするようにマークを付けます。
  3. cygwin.exeを起動し、好みのディレクトリに移動します(私のものはD:/Android/sources/4.0/try2)。例:$: cd /cygdrive/d/Android/sources/4.0/try2

  4. 以下の手順を1つずつ実行します。

    私)mkdir bin

    ii)PATH=/cygdrive/d/Android/sources/4.0/try2/bin:$PATH

    iii)curl https://storage.googleapis.com/git-repo-downloads/repo > /cygdrive/d/Android/sources/4.0/try2/bin/repo

    iv)mkdir source

    v)cd source

    vi)
    マスターブランチ:
    repo init -u https://android.googlesource.com/platform/manifest

    たとえば、4.0.1ブランチ:
    repo init -u https://android.googlesource.com/platform/manifest -b android-4.0.1_r1

    vii)必要に応じて資格情報を提供する

    viii)repo sync

出典:ここをクリック

于 2014-02-02T13:54:46.577 に答える
1

1)Gitをインストールします:http://git-scm.com/

2)[Git Bashスタート]メニュー> [Git]>[GitBash]から開きます

3)Git Bashウィンドウで、次のコマンドを使用して、現在のディレクトリをお気に入りのディレクトリ(D:\ android_srcなど)に変更します。cd /d/androidsrc/

4)Windowsエクスプローラーで、空のファイルD:\android_src\download.shを作成し、メモ帳で開きます

5)次のリンクを開き、コードをコピーしてに貼り付けD:\android_src\download.sh、メモ帳を保存して閉じます。

http://pastebin.com/DfqBFKnK

6)次のコマンドを使用して、GitBashウィンドウでダウンロードシェルスクリプトを実行します。./download.sh

参照: https ://android.googlesource.com/

于 2013-12-27T22:45:47.950 に答える
0

cygwinをインストールし、gitのcygwinバージョンをインストールしてから、リポジトリをインストールするための通常の手順に従います。

とにかくgitを使用する必要があります。これは、最新の開発作業の標準的なvcsになっています。まだsvnにあるものもありますが、それは終わりに近づいています。

于 2011-08-06T23:41:59.507 に答える
0

私にとって最も簡単な方法は、GrepCodeで閲覧することです。

于 2012-07-22T14:05:25.893 に答える